Oregon's climate, with its wet winters and mild summers, demands materials and construction techniques that resist moisture and decay. Projects often focus on improving drainage, upgrading roofing, and enhancing insulation for energy efficiency. The permitting process in Oregon is generally well-defined, and we guide clients through each step to ensure full compliance.

The housing stock in Salem and across Oregon ranges from mid-century ranch homes to newer constructions, each presenting opportunities for modernization. Is $50,000 enough to remodel a house?

The feasibility of a $50,000 home remodel in Oregon depends on the scale of the project. Larger renovations, like a full kitchen or bathroom update, will likely exceed this budget. Smaller cosmetic upgrades or targeted room improvements are more achievable within this figure.

What is the most expensive part of a house to renovate?

Kitchens and bathrooms are consistently the most costly renovation areas due to complex plumbing, electrical, and the installation of premium fixtures and finishes.
